Ticket OX-218 — Move Pinebarrow build to hermetic toolchain. So, turns out our old build was pulling whatever compiler happened to be on the runner, which is... not great for reproducibility or your audit. We've migrated to the Sealcrate sandbox: pinned toolchain, vendored deps, no network during compile. Two stragglers remain (the docs generator and a codegen step) but the main binary is fully hermetic now. Reproduce it yourself and compare against the attestation token below.

trace token, taguf-yajop: htk6_3fef6e

## Limits & Quotas: Token Refresh

If you're on call and seeing a flood of 401s from the Bramblegate API, it's probably the session-token refresh bug again — clients hammer the refresh endpoint when their clocks drift. We added rate limits per client and a grace window so legit users don't get locked out. Before paging the auth team, check whether traffic exceeds the limits below.

tuning table, fawip-fahag:
WEIGHTS = {
    "novwyn": 452,
    "casdor": 675,
}

Facilities Ticket — Cleaning Crew Access, Brindle Annex

For new starters handling evening lock-up: the Sorano Cleaning crew arrives nightly at 21:30 via the annex side door. Check their rota sheet, note arrival in the log, and ensure the storeroom is relocked afterward. To let them through the side door, enter the access code below.

badge for yaweg-hafog: bdg-GX-6

**Mgmt Meeting Minutes — Retiring the Brightline Range**

Quick recap for sales leads at Fenholt Supplies: we agreed to retire the Brightline fixture range by year-end. Remaining stock moves to clearance pricing next month, and accounts on standing orders get migrated to the Lumetta range. Trade-in incentives were approved in principle. The confidential note on next steps sits just below.

board note of bajof-bajeg: The pricing group signed off on a budget of $13.4 million for Project Sildor. The renewal with Lamixek Holdings closes at $48.9 million a year, 49 percent above the last contract.